技术文摘
C#中Access数据库连接字符串错误的解决办法
C#中Access数据库连接字符串错误的解决办法
在C#开发中,与Access数据库建立连接是一项常见的任务。然而,有时候可能会遇到连接字符串错误的问题,这会导致程序无法正确连接到数据库。本文将介绍一些常见的连接字符串错误及解决办法。
最常见的错误之一是数据库路径错误。在连接字符串中,必须准确指定Access数据库文件的路径。如果路径不正确,程序将无法找到数据库文件。解决这个问题的方法是仔细检查连接字符串中的数据库路径,确保路径是正确的,并且包含数据库文件的完整名称和扩展名。
连接字符串的格式错误也可能导致问题。在C#中,连接字符串的格式通常是特定的,需要遵循一定的规则。例如,对于Access 2003及以下版本,连接字符串的格式可能与Access 2007及以上版本有所不同。对于较新版本的Access,常用的连接字符串格式可能包含"Provider=Microsoft.ACE.OLEDB.12.0"等信息。如果格式不正确,程序将无法正确解析连接字符串。此时,需要参考相关文档,确保连接字符串的格式正确。
另外,权限问题也可能导致连接字符串错误。如果程序没有足够的权限访问数据库文件,即使连接字符串正确,也无法建立连接。解决这个问题的方法是检查数据库文件的权限设置,确保程序具有访问该文件的权限。
还有一种情况是缺少必要的依赖项。在使用某些数据库驱动程序时,可能需要安装相应的依赖项才能正常连接到数据库。例如,使用ACE OLEDB驱动程序时,需要确保计算机上已经安装了相应的驱动。如果缺少依赖项,需要下载并安装相应的驱动程序。
在遇到C#中Access数据库连接字符串错误时,要仔细检查数据库路径、连接字符串格式、权限设置以及依赖项等方面的问题。通过逐步排查和解决这些问题,能够顺利建立与Access数据库的连接,确保程序的正常运行。
- 拯救者 R9000X 重装 Win11 的步骤详解
- 红米 Redmi G Pro 重装 Win11 的步骤
- ThinkPad X1 Carbon 轻松重装 Win11 系统教程
- Win11 商业版与消费版的差异及优劣对比
- Win11 切换壁纸闪屏的解决之道
- 华硕笔记本重装 Win11 系统方法:一键重装教程
- 更新 Win11 后 C 盘变小的应对策略
- Win11 家庭版与旗舰版的差异解析
- Win11 文件管理器的位置详解
- Microsoft Store 提示 0x80070483 的解决之道
- Win11 最新 22h2 版本解析与下载分享
- Win11 专业版游戏流畅优化系统
- Win11 升级后无法安装软件的解决之道
- 2022 年 Win11 22H2 极速流畅版系统下载(丝滑至极)
- 荣耀笔记本 Win11 系统一键安装操作步骤分享